To be a journeyman electrical contractor implies to be on the 2nd degree of seniority in a three-phase electrical profession. The stages are as follows: pupil, journeyman, and master electrical expert. While some journeymen work for electrical business, others are freelance. Journeymen might function on residential, industrial, or commercial residential properties, each of which features its own set of responsibilities.


No matter, all electrical experts are anticipated to perform the very best methods for electric security and abide by the National Electric Code (NEC). Many of a journeyman's job entails installing, connecting, checking, fixing, and maintaining electrical systems and parts, consisting of circuitry, electrical outlets, appliances, electric buttons, circuit breakers, security systems, and lights.


All journeyman and master electrical experts must be licensed to legitimately function - lafayette electricians. Apprenticeships often last three to five years and are provided by numerous companies, neighborhood unions, or licensed electrical contractors eager to coach and have someone work under them.
